CSCuw52512—A scheduled script is staging twice.
Symptom
A scheduled script (from the Control Panel > Schedule screen) is staging twice within 10 
seconds.
Conditions
The following steps recreate the conditions when this defect occurs:
1.
From Control Panel > Schedule, schedule a script.
2.
Observe the Control Panel > Control > Staging screen.
Two instances of the script are staged. This can also be confirmed in the log files.
Workaround
There is no workaround.
